DATA SOVEREIGNTY AS A DESIGN PRINCIPLE FOR DIGITAL INFRASTRUCTURE
Mark Pestridge, Executive Vice President and General Manager, Telehouse Europe; Sami Slim, CEO, Telehouse France and Takeyuki Yanagisawa, General Manager, Telehouse Business Planning Department, KDDI, on how data sovereignty is reshaping the design, governance and operation of digital infrastructure across global markets.
As digital ecosystems expand, data sovereignty has become a defining consideration in how infrastructure is built and governed. For enterprises, the challenge lies in finding the right balance. Infrastructure must enable global collaboration while respecting local laws, ensuring innovation can continue within data residency and transfer boundaries.
The balance is increasingly being tested, as a growing number of regulators across Europe have imposed billions of euros in penalties for breaches of data protection and data sovereignty rules since GDPR enforcement began, with annual totals now often climbing into the high hundreds of millions.
Authorities in North America, Asia-Pacific, Latin America and the Middle East are following suit, strengthening privacy frameworks and tightening control of crossborder data flows.
Infrastructure decisions are no longer purely technical. They are shaped by regulatory and geopolitical factors, raising the bar for data centre operators. www. intelligentcio. com
